The Best Wood for a Floating Shelf

Almost any sort of hardwood performs properly when generating a floating shelf. Nonetheless, you are going to most likely have the very best accomplishment with oak, maple, pine mahogany, and sound walnut. Each and every assortment is powerful and either appears desirable or accepts stains effectively, which assists you tailor the appearance to your specifications. Pine is very likely the simplest to find and least high-priced of the varieties outlined here, even though oak is regarded as one of the most durable materials on the market place right now and is straightforward to clear and sustain. Maplewood is a well-liked option for instruments, and its hugely eye-catching wooden grain can assist you create amazing-seeking shelves. Mahogany has a darkish purple shade that a lot of individuals enjoy, and walnut has a normal splendor that lasts a extended time.

How Do I Install a Floating Shelf?

Installing a floating shelf is a two-step approach. The 1st action calls for you to screw a prolonged shelf bracket into the wall. This bracket will have a number of long pegs that extend out from the wall. The next step demands you to line up the holes in the board with the internet pages and slide them into spot. The pegs in the holes must have a snug suit so the shelf doesn’t slide away from the wall very easily. Some people also screw the board into the wall from underneath for further assist.

How Thick Are Floating Shelves?

Most of the floating shelves that you can locate, the two commercially and homemade, are about 2 inches thick. This thickness permits you to generate holes for great-sized pegs that will enable the shelf to maintain much more fat with out triggering the entire style to grow to be way too large for the wall. This thickness also appears good from a distance and will help it show up strong with out being cumbersome.

Problems With Floating Shelves

Even though floating cabinets are a excellent option for numerous individuals, they are not best for absolutely everyone. They simply cannot support as much bodyweight as cabinets with supports. So, you cannot use them for heavy objects, and considering that there are no sides, some objects can fall off simpler, particularly spherical products. Floating shelves are also generally scaled-down than regular cabinets, which means there’s significantly less area to place items, and you could require much more to fit almost everything.
